Sherline headstocks and parts been available in a variety of designs from the factory. Typically ER16 and MT1. Both of which are very small. Sherline likewise provides WW collet sets for extremely tiny work. Generally watchmakers and clockmakers use the WW collets. The majority of prefer ER25, ER32 or perhaps ER40 collet sizes with a larger spindle go through hole. The 5C collet for the Sherline lathe would be the best. For Sherline mills, most actually do not care for the MT1 and barely like the ER16. An R8 spindle with a low profile would be best. It provides the most versatility and numerous tool options. Taig also offers lathes and mills. It’s Sherlines primary competition. In reality, you can find a great deal of videos and short articles describing Taig vs Sherline. The Taig products offer far more stiff ways and typically more “heavy duty” in general. The Taig motors are pretty weak, similar to the Sherline motors. A high quality brushless motor can make the machine seem like a totally various mill or lathe. Taig likewise uses a good CNC all set mill and lathe. You can also select their digital CNC system which uses closed-looped steppers and Mach3 software. The Taig spindles have the same issues as the Sherline. They are far too little. The only exception is the 5C collet headstock design they offer. We will do a review of the 5C in the future. The good thing is that they now provide a ballscrew alternative for their mill and lathe. Plus, the deal a “gang tool” lathe. The downside with both makes is the lack of severe upgrades.
Sherline offers many parts and attachments, but not much to make it a better machine. To begin with, they headstock usages poor quality bearings and the bearings are too small. This indicates the spindle itself needs to be small. A spindle with really little mass implies the lathe or mill the finish quality will not be as excellent and based on vibration problems. For instance, they use many lathe devices, however you can’t get a 5C headstock or ER25, ER32 or ER40. Plus, the go through hole needs to be small due to the fact that the bearings are little. There is a similar problem with the mill. You can just utilize ER16 collets and this restricts its usage. Of course those in Matheny, West Virginia 24860 may have different needs.
